Field of Glory II: A Deep Dive into Ancient Warfare
Introduction to the Game
Field of Glory II, developed by Slitherine Software, is a historical wargame that transports players to the ancient world, where they command armies from various civilizations in epic battles. This game offers a rich and complex experience, allowing players to delve into the intricacies of ancient warfare and experience the thrill of leading armies to victory.
Gameplay Overview
Field of Glory II is a turn-based tactical wargame played on a hexagonal grid. Players take turns moving their units, engaging in combat, and attempting to achieve their objectives. The game features a wide variety of units, each with unique strengths and weaknesses, and a detailed system for resolving combat.
Key Features:
- Historically Accurate Units: The game features a vast array of units, from foot soldiers to cavalry and chariots, each with their own stats, equipment, and historical background.
- Detailed Combat System: The combat system is highly nuanced, taking into account factors like unit type, terrain, morale, and leadership.
- Strategic Deployment: Players need to carefully consider their unit placement and formations to maximize their effectiveness in battle.
- Multiple Game Modes: Field of Glory II offers various game modes, including historical battles, custom scenarios, and campaigns.
- Extensive Modding Support: The game has a thriving modding community, allowing players to create custom units, scenarios, and even entire campaigns.
A Walkthrough: Mastering the Basics
1. Choosing Your Army:
- The game offers a wide range of civilizations, each with its own unique units and playstyle.
- Consider factors like unit composition, strengths and weaknesses, and historical context when choosing your army.
2. Deploying Your Forces:
- Carefully position your units based on their strengths and the terrain.
- Utilize formations to maximize the effectiveness of your units.
- Consider the deployment of archers, cavalry, and heavy infantry to create a balanced army.
3. Engaging in Combat:
- The game uses a dice-rolling system to resolve combat.
- Factors like unit type, terrain, morale, and leadership influence the outcome of battles.
- Utilize terrain to your advantage, and try to flank your opponents.
4. Managing Morale and Leadership:
- Units can become demoralized if they suffer heavy losses or if their leader is killed.
- Leaders can inspire their troops and improve their morale.
- Keep an eye on your unit’s morale and take steps to prevent them from breaking.
5. Achieving Victory:
- Each scenario has its own objectives, which can include destroying enemy units, capturing objectives, or achieving a certain number of points.
- Develop a strategy to achieve your objectives and outmaneuver your opponent.
